The CCJB shall assist the Fifth Judicial District in the development, establishment and maintenance of community - based corrections programs, providing the judicial system with sentencing alternatives for certain misdemeanants or persons convicted of non-violent felonies, on whom the court may impose a jail sentence.
The CCJB acts as both policy and advisory Board for the Fifth Judicial District Community Corrections Program.
The CCJB serves as a direct link to the communities of the Fifth District consisting of major segments of the local criminal justice system.
The CCJB is charged with development of a Biennial Community Criminal Justice Plan setting the direction of criminal justice in our communities.
The CCJB assist the localities in evaluating and monitoring community programs, services and facilities to determine their impact on offenders.
